public interface jdk.internal.joptsimple.OptionDeclarer
  minor version: 0
  major version: 59
  flags: flags: (0x0601) ACC_PUBLIC, ACC_INTERFACE, ACC_ABSTRACT
  this_class: jdk.internal.joptsimple.OptionDeclarer
  super_class: java.lang.Object
{
  public abstract jdk.internal.joptsimple.OptionSpecBuilder accepts(java.lang.String);
    descriptor: (Ljava/lang/String;)Ljdk/internal/joptsimple/OptionSpecBuilder;
    flags: (0x0401) ACC_PUBLIC, ACC_ABSTRACT
    MethodParameters:
        Name  Flags
      option  

  public abstract jdk.internal.joptsimple.OptionSpecBuilder accepts(java.lang.String, java.lang.String);
    descriptor: (Ljava/lang/String;Ljava/lang/String;)Ljdk/internal/joptsimple/OptionSpecBuilder;
    flags: (0x0401) ACC_PUBLIC, ACC_ABSTRACT
    MethodParameters:
             Name  Flags
      option       
      description  

  public abstract jdk.internal.joptsimple.OptionSpecBuilder acceptsAll(java.util.List<java.lang.String>);
    descriptor: (Ljava/util/List;)Ljdk/internal/joptsimple/OptionSpecBuilder;
    flags: (0x0401) ACC_PUBLIC, ACC_ABSTRACT
    Signature: (Ljava/util/List<Ljava/lang/String;>;)Ljdk/internal/joptsimple/OptionSpecBuilder;
    MethodParameters:
         Name  Flags
      options  

  public abstract jdk.internal.joptsimple.OptionSpecBuilder acceptsAll(java.util.List<java.lang.String>, java.lang.String);
    descriptor: (Ljava/util/List;Ljava/lang/String;)Ljdk/internal/joptsimple/OptionSpecBuilder;
    flags: (0x0401) ACC_PUBLIC, ACC_ABSTRACT
    Signature: (Ljava/util/List<Ljava/lang/String;>;Ljava/lang/String;)Ljdk/internal/joptsimple/OptionSpecBuilder;
    MethodParameters:
             Name  Flags
      options      
      description  

  public abstract jdk.internal.joptsimple.NonOptionArgumentSpec<java.lang.String> nonOptions();
    descriptor: ()Ljdk/internal/joptsimple/NonOptionArgumentSpec;
    flags: (0x0401) ACC_PUBLIC, ACC_ABSTRACT
    Signature: ()Ljdk/internal/joptsimple/NonOptionArgumentSpec<Ljava/lang/String;>;

  public abstract jdk.internal.joptsimple.NonOptionArgumentSpec<java.lang.String> nonOptions(java.lang.String);
    descriptor: (Ljava/lang/String;)Ljdk/internal/joptsimple/NonOptionArgumentSpec;
    flags: (0x0401) ACC_PUBLIC, ACC_ABSTRACT
    Signature: (Ljava/lang/String;)Ljdk/internal/joptsimple/NonOptionArgumentSpec<Ljava/lang/String;>;
    MethodParameters:
             Name  Flags
      description  

  public abstract void posixlyCorrect(boolean);
    descriptor: (Z)V
    flags: (0x0401) ACC_PUBLIC, ACC_ABSTRACT
    MethodParameters:
         Name  Flags
      setting  

  public abstract void allowsUnrecognizedOptions();
    descriptor: ()V
    flags: (0x0401) ACC_PUBLIC, ACC_ABSTRACT

  public abstract void recognizeAlternativeLongOptions(boolean);
    descriptor: (Z)V
    flags: (0x0401) ACC_PUBLIC, ACC_ABSTRACT
    MethodParameters:
           Name  Flags
      recognize  
}
SourceFile: "OptionDeclarer.java"